The roofing work in Michigan is heavily influenced by its cold winters, which bring significant snow and ice. Proper roof pitch, underlayment, and attic ventilation are critical to prevent ice dams and water intrusion. Summer's humidity also demands attention to material breathability and durability. What roof shingles to stay away from?

In Michigan, avoid asphalt shingles that are not rated for cold temperatures and heavy snow loads, as they are prone to cracking. Shingles with poor wind resistance can also be a liability during severe weather. We recommend materials engineered to perform under our state's consistent winter conditions.

How does insulation affect my roof's performance in Michigan?

Proper roof insulation in Michigan is essential for managing cold winters and preventing ice dams. It keeps the attic space cooler in summer, reducing heat transfer into living areas, and significantly reduces heat loss in winter. This temperature regulation helps prevent condensation and the formation of damaging ice buildup on the roof.
